Trump Nominates Brooke Rollins as Agriculture Secretary to Support American Farmers

Trump Nominates Brooke Rollins as Agriculture Secretary to Support American Farmers

November 23, 2024 Catherine Williams - Chief Editor News

Donald Trump has chosen Brooke Rollins as the next Secretary of Agriculture. She is the president of the America First Policy Institute. Trump praised Rollins, stating she will protect American farmers, who are vital to the country.

If the Senate confirms her, Rollins will oversee a large agency with 100,000 employees. The Department of Agriculture manages farm programs, food safety, and rural development, among other tasks. The agency had a budget of $437.2 billion in 2024.

Rollins’s role will affect American diets and budgets. She will guide trade deals, dietary recommendations, and support rural broadband. Trump emphasized her dedication to American farmers and rural communities.

In her response, Rollins expressed gratitude for the nomination, stating it is an honor to serve. She shared her enthusiasm for supporting farmers and promoting agricultural communities.

As agriculture secretary, Rollins will advise the administration on biofuels and clean fuel-tax credits. She will also help renegotiate the US-Mexico-Canada trade deal, addressing issues like genetically modified corn and dairy quotas.
